Early Life and Education Ruth Wilson's formative years and academic background provide insight into the actress's early life and education. Born on January 13, 1982, in Ashford, Surrey, England, Wilson grew up in a creative environment, with her mother, Mary, working as a probation officer and her father, Nigel Wilson, serving as an investment banker. Wilson attended Notre Dame School, an independent Catholic school for girls, where her passion for acting began to flourish. She later pursued a degree in history at the University of Nottingham, followed by an MA in acting from the London Academy of Music and Dramatic Art (LAMDA). Career Highlights With a string of notable roles across film, television, and stage, Ruth Wilson has established herself as a versatile and acclaimed performer in the entertainment industry. One of her career highlights includes her portrayal of Alice Morgan in the BBC psychological crime drama series 'Luther,' where she captivated audiences with her complex and enigmatic character. Wilson's performance in 'Luther' earned her critical acclaim and several award nominations, showcasing her talent and range as an actress. Another significant career moment for Wilson was her role as Alison Lockhart in the Showtime drama series 'The Affair.' Her portrayal of Alison, a troubled and conflicted woman caught in a tumultuous extramarital affair, earned her a Golden Globe Award for Best Actress in a Television Series Drama.
